September 2, 1973 – May 10, 2019

WENDELL – Bryan Pulley, 45, died Friday.  He was born in Wake County.  He worked as an Assistant Superintendent with the Nash Correctional Institution & was a past Worshipful Master.  He was preceded in death by his parents, Jimmy Pulley & Carolyn Alford Pulley.

Funeral 11 am, Tuesday, Hales Chapel Baptist Church with burial in the church cemetery.

He is survived by his wife, Jennifer Hinton Pulley, son, Brandon Pulley, daughter, Jessica Pulley, brother, Jimmy Pulley (Amy) of Clayton,

In lieu of flowers memorial contributions may be made to  the Pulley Family Fund c/o any SECU Visitation 6-7:30 pm, Monday, Strickland Funeral Home, 211 W. Third St., Wendell & other times at the home.  www.stricklandfuneral.com
